How Much is Piano Disc

The price of a PianoDisc system varies, typically ranging from $5,000 to $10,000. This cost depends on the model and features selected.

PianoDisc is a sophisticated player piano technology that transforms pianos into modern entertainment systems. By installing this system, pianists and music enthusiasts can enjoy a wide variety of music genres played automatically on their acoustic piano. Equipped with state-of-the-art features such as ProRecord and SilentDrive HD, PianoDisc allows for recording, silent practicing, and integration with mobile devices.

As a leading innovation in the piano industry, it offers an extensive music library and compatibility with various piano models, making it a top choice for those looking to merge traditional instruments with contemporary technology. Cost Factors For Piano Disc

Understanding how much a Piano Disc costs involves several factors. Different models and custom options affect the price. Let’s explore these cost factors to help you make an informed decision.

Base Models And Pricing

Base models of Piano Disc provide the essential experience. Prices for these models vary. A basic system includes silent play and a range of pre-installed songs. Here are the common price ranges for entry-level systems:

Model Price Range
Disc Classic $4,000 – $5,000
Disc GT2 $6,000 – $7,000
Disc Prodigy $7,000 – $8,000

Customization And Additional Features

Upgrading from a base model means more features. These can lead to higher costs. Customizations enhance the playability and enjoyment of your piano. They include:

  • Wireless connectivity
  • Advanced sound libraries
  • Additional song selections
  • User recording capabilities

The price for these extras can start from a few hundred to thousands, depending on the options chosen. Integration of advanced technology like ProRecord or the installation of a high-fidelity speaker system can increase the price significantly. Here’s a simple breakdown of potential added costs:

  1. Wireless adaptors: $200 – $300
  2. Expanded song library: $100 – $1,000+
  3. ProRecord option: $1,500 – $2,000
  4. High-fidelity speakers: $1,000 – $4,000

Frequently Asked Questions For How Much Is Piano Disc

How Much Does It Cost To Add A Player System To A Piano?

Adding a player system to a piano typically costs between $5,000 and $10,000, depending on the system’s features and installation complexity.

Can I Upgrade My Pianodisc?

Yes, you can upgrade your PianoDisc system. Contact an authorized dealer for compatibility and service options.

How Much Is The Self-playing Piano System?

The cost of a self-playing piano system typically ranges from $5,000 to over $20,000, depending on the make, model, and features.

What Is Pianodisc Prodigy?

PianoDisc Prodigy is an advanced player piano system that transforms regular pianos into self-playing instruments through sophisticated technology. It offers seamless integration, wireless control, and a vast music library.
